Crash on I-75 leaves one person dead, another seriously injured
LEXINGTON, Ky. (ABC36 NEWS NOW) – Parts of I-75 Southbound were shut down Saturday afternoon due to a deadly crash involving three vehicles.
Lexington Police say a reckless driver was reported around 4:15 p.m. near mile marker 102.
52-year-old Kevin Dailey was pronounced dead at the scene by the Fayette County Coroner.
LPD says two other people were taken to the hospital. One with life-threatening injuries and the other with non-life-threatening injuries.
The investigation into the accident is still ongoing.
